The AMD Ryzen 5 5600X features 6 processor cores and has the capability to manage 12 threads concurrently.
It was released in Q4/2020 and belongs to the 4 generation of the AMD Ryzen 5 series.
To use the AMD Ryzen 5 5600X, you'll need a motherboard with a AM4 (PGA 1331) socket.
The AMD RX-416GD features 2 processor cores and has the capability to manage 2 threads concurrently.
It was released in 2015 and belongs to the 1 generation of the AMD R series.
To use the AMD RX-416GD, you'll need a motherboard with a FP4 socket.

The AMD Ryzen 5 5600X does not have integrated graphics.
The AMD RX-416GD has integrated graphics, called iGPU for short.
Specifically, the AMD RX-416GD uses the AMD Radeon R6 (Merlin Falcon), which has 384 texture shaders
and 6 execution units.
The iGPU uses the system's main memory as graphics memory and sits on the processor's die.
